在过去的十年里,加密货币的迅猛发展引起了广泛关注,尤其是比特币及其背后的区块链技术。在这一切的核心,便是“共识机制”。共识机制不仅是加密货币系统的基础,也是确保区块链网络安全和有效运行的关键。本文将深入探讨加密货币共识的概念、实现方法、类型及其在真实环境中的应用与挑战。通过详细阐述这一主题,希望能帮助读者更好地理解这些复杂的机制,并在必要时对其进行合理应用。
共识机制是区块链网络中用于确保所有参与者对账户状态和区块数据达成一致的协议。由于区块链是一种去中心化的技术,意味着没有单一的控制者,网络中的每位参与者都有可能对数据进行修改。在这种情况下,不同节点之间需要一种方法来验证和确认交易,以防止欺诈和双重支付等问题的产生。
共识机制确保了网络的安全性、透明性和可靠性。只有在达成共识的情况下,新的区块才能被添加到区块链上。具体来说,任何一个节点都不能仅凭个人意愿随意篡改信息,必须得到其余节点的认可并遵循共识协议。
共识机制有多种形式,下面将重点介绍几种主流的共识机制及其各自的优缺点:
工作量证明是比特币和许多其他加密货币所使用的共识机制。在这种机制中,矿工需要解决一个复杂的数学难题,以便获得区块的创建权。解决这个难题需要耗费大量的计算资源和时间,确保了网络的安全性。
优点:
1. 安全性高。由于需要大量的计算和能源投入,攻击者很难通过控制大多数算力来进行篡改。
2. 经验证的成熟机制。自比特币发布以来,PoW已经在多个项目中得到了应用。
缺点:
1. 能源消耗巨大。尤其是在比特币挖矿中,严重影响了环境。
2. 矿工集中化。由于挖矿所需的资金和设备,导致少数大型矿工垄断了网络。
权益证明是一种较新的共识机制,鼓励用户根据他们所持有的加密货币数量来参与网络的验证。在PoS中,节点的验证机会与其持有的资产数量成正比,这样,用户的利益与网络的安全性直接挂钩。
优点:
1. 能源效率高。与PoW相比,PoS所需的能源较少,有助于降低环境影响。
2. 促进长期投资。持有代币的用户倾向于关注网络的长期发展。
缺点:
1. 富者愈富的现象。持有较多代币的用户更有可能获得更多的奖励,可能导致财富不平等。
2. 附带的安全问题。某些PoS实现可能易受到“长程攻击”等威胁。
在委托权益证明中,代币持有者会投票选出一些“代表”来验证交易和创建区块。选出的代表会负责网络的治理,因此DPoS在一定程度上是一种民主化的共识机制。
优点:
1. 高效性。相较于PoW和PoS,DPoS能够更快地确认交易,提高了网络的吞吐量。
2. 去中心化治理。代币持有者可以通过投票参与项目的治理,增强社区的参与感。
缺点:
1. 中心化风险。虽然DPoS引入了选举机制,但仍然可能导致少数代表垄断权力。
2. 投票机制复杂。有些用户可能由于缺乏足够的信息或理解障碍而无法做出明智的投票决定。
不同类型的共识机制在实际应用中会面临不同的挑战和机遇。例如,PoW常常面临能源消耗的批评,导致许多新项目更倾向于使用PoS或DPoS。然而,尽管后者更加节能,但仍然在证券法合规和治理结构上面临挑战。
此外,随着市场的不断变化,许多项目选择混合多种共识机制以发挥各自优势。例如,以太坊2.0将从PoW迁移至PoS,旨在解决效率和可扩展性问题。此举不仅能够减轻网络的能源消耗,也希望能吸引更多的用户和开发者参与。
共识机制在保障加密货币安全方面至关重要。以PoW为例,该机制通过大量计算和电力投入确保网络安全,使得恶意攻击者很难控制大多数算力,从而有效抵御双重支付和信息篡改。当网络劣于攻击者的算力时,攻击就可能发生。无需担心的是,在设计良好的共识机制下,诚实节点的数量大于攻击者,从而维持网络的完整性。
相对而言,权益证明机制的安全性则更多依赖于经济模型。持有代币的用户必然会面临因攻击而导致的资产贬值,因此在大多数情况下,他们会倾向于维护网络的安全。而在某些情况下,如长程攻击,DPoS可能受到的威胁要大于前两者,但通过合理的选举和投票机制,也能降低这些风险。总之,共识机制在架构上决定了网络的安全性,因而在加密货币的设立过程中必须重视其设计。
选择不同的共识机制是基于多种因素,包括技术创新、市场需求以及项目的具体目标。例如,比特币采用PoW是因为其追求极高的安全性和去中心化,而以太坊在发展过程中逐步决定过渡至PoS,以更好地处理可扩展性问题。除了安全性考虑外,项目团队对于速度、效能以及用户参与度等方面的权衡也会影响共识机制的选择。
在某些情况下,即使是同一加密货币的不同版本,也可能因为社区实践和技术需求的不同而选择不同的共识机制。例如,某些区块链平台基于灵活性而合并了多种共识机制,以满足不同场景下的需要。对于新建项目而言,选择合适的共识机制也是吸引投资者和用户的重要因素,这也与平台的业务模式、技术栈紧密相关。
可扩展性是指网络能够处理的交易数量与速度。如果共识机制效率不足,尤其是在交易量激增的情况下,网络可能出现拥堵,导致交易确认时间延长,用户体验下降。不同共识机制在可扩展性上的表现存在显著差异。
例如,PoW因其复杂的计算过程,通常在交易确认速度上不如PoS和DPoS,更容易在用户数量激增时瓶颈严重。而PoS和DPoS因机制设计允许更高的吞吐量和更快的确认时间,通常被认为在不牺牲安全性的情况下能积极促进网络的可扩展性。随着技术的发展,联合使用多重机制也逐步成为解决可扩展性问题的可能手段,各项目团队需结合自身实际找到合适的共识机制。
随着加密货币行业的快速发展,法律合规问题逐渐受到重视。不同的共识机制可能会为法律合规带来不一样的挑战。对于以权益证明为主的加密货币,由于其设定让持有代币的用户具有较强的发言权部分机构可能会将其视作众筹,从而需要遵循证券法要求。在某些地区,还可能面临反洗钱和反恐融资私隐等要求。
相应地,使用工作量证明的项目则可能面临环境法规的关注,随着对能源消耗的日益重视,采取该机制的项目必须考虑更为复杂的法律环境。从长远来看,合规问题不仅影响项目的可持续发展,更可能影响到用户的参与度。为了应对这些挑战,项目方需在设计共识机制的同时,积极寻求法律专业人士的咨询,以确保合规性的提升与目标的一致性。
随着技术与市场环境的变化,共识机制将在未来不断演进。当前,结合多种机制、提升效率与安全性是未来的一个发展趋势。尤其是在大规模应用逐步向去中心化金融(DeFi)、非可替代代币(NFT)等新兴领域延伸时,项目需要更加灵活的共识机制来适应变化的需求。
另外,锚定现实资产、大数据与人工智能相结合的共识方案也有望成为未来的研究方向,力求在性能、用户体验与合规之间找到平衡。针对文中提到的每一类共识机制,创新团队都在探索更高效、更环保的替代方案,未来或会涌现出兼具高效性与安全性的全新共识机制。
共识机制是加密货币生态的重要基础,通过多种方式解决了网络安全与效率之间的平衡问题。在日益激烈的竞争环境中,选择合适的共识机制对于项目的长期发展至关重要,也将影响到市场的未来走向。未来的研究和实践将继续推动共识机制的演化,带来更安全、高效的区块链应用,改变我们的生活。希望通过本文的探讨,读者能对加密货币共识机制有更深入的了解,并在未来的投资或开发工作中做出明智的选择。